Every engagement begins with ClearPath, our rapid financial deep dive
DAY 1 — Data Intake
We gather and organize the financial information needed to understand your business.
DAY 2 — Financial Analysis
We analyze your financial position, cash flow, risks, and opportunities.
DAY 3 — Findings & Priorities
You receive a clear picture of where the business stands and what needs attention first.
This includes an initial 13-week cash-flow forecast, current cash run rate, and realistic view of your cashrunway.
From there, ClearLedger works toward clean, reliable financial reporting and builds a Strategic Financial Plan around your goals.

Growing businesses lose profit in places owners can't easily see. We find it and help you fix it.
We systematically analyze your business to uncover hidden profit leaks, including:
Pricing & discounting
Labor & overtimeVendor costs
Merchant processing feesInsurance & softwareInventory
Customer & product profitability
Operational inefficiencies
Margin compression
We identify where profit is leaking and determine which financial and operational changes can help recover it.
